When I bought it new, I think it cost about $120. A lot of money for a kid to save in 1966. No worry about the Instant On feature now since it's not plugged in except for rare occasions.

I remember back in the day the thought was that the Instant On feature's warmth minimized humidity issues and lessened surges. I know it produced other issues at least for some TVs.
